Responsibilities

The Calibration Specialist is responsible for performing the calibration and repair of various instrumentation within the facility that is used for monitoring both Critical and Non-Critical process parameters related to various manufacturing and support functions used to determine Quality decisions.  Will participate in the coordination of calibration activities in order to meet established Quality, regulatory and customer requirements.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Calibrate / maintain analytical laboratory instruments according to site SOP’s. Coordinate vendor calibrations for on-site or off-site calibration service.
  • Review and approve vendor calibration documents per site standard operating procedures.
  • Maintain orderly, accurate, and accessible records of calibration maintenance and repairs performed on all instruments in compliance with cGMP/cGLP requirements.
  • Prepare / revise instrument calibration and preventive maintenance SOP’s for new and existing instruments.
  • Distribute monthly calibration schedules generated from the calibration data management system to Operation/Production Management and department supervisors.
  • Ensure that the metrology’s standards, tools, and other equipment are securely stored. Ensure all equipment, manuals, tools, etc. are properly returned to the delegated storage at the end of the day.
  • Develop expertise in the maintenance, operation, and troubleshooting of laboratory analytical equipment.
  • Troubleshoot and perform repairs on site instruments as needed.
  • Assist supporting departments on the selection of new, replacement of test and measurement devices.
  • Maintain Calibration files for ease of retrieving metrology documentation for audits and customer requests.
  • All employees are responsible for ensuring the compliance to company documents, programs and activities related to the Health, Safety, Environment, Energy, and Quality Management Systems, as per your roles and responsibilities

Job Requirements:

  • Associate Degree in Electronics, or Science related field or equivalent practical experience strongly preferred
  • 1-year relevant work experience ideally in a regulated environment required.
  • Preferred formal Military PMEL Training

What We Do

Fresenius Kabi is a global healthcare company that specializes in lifesaving medicines and technologies for infusion, transfusion, and clinical nutrition. The company’s products and services are used for the therapy and care of critically and chronically ill patients. Its product portfolio comprises a range of highly complex biopharmaceuticals, clinical nutrition, medical technologies, and I.V. generic drugs. Within biopharmaceuticals, Fresenius Kabi offers, among others, biosimilar drugs with a focus on autoimmune diseases and oncology. The company’s clinical nutrition offering includes a wide selection of enteral and parenteral nutrition products. In the segment of medical technologies, its offering includes vital disposables, infusions pumps, apheresis machines, cell therapy devices, and more.
